Business & Innovation Strategy Manager

Remote Full-time
Posting Period From January 28, 2026 to February 28, 2026 Country or region May vary Location Home office Business Unit Biofuels and Distilled Spirits Department Administration Entry date As soon as possible Job Status Permanent - Full time Minimal required work experience 7 years Minimal education level required Bachelor's Degree Salary To be determined Benefits Competitive social benefits BUSINESS & INNOVATION STRATEGY MANAGER MAIN FUNCTIONS Role Context The position is execution-oriented, with a strong emphasis on innovation and business case development for product launches. The Business Development Manager will complement the R&D validation that exists today with consistent commercial planning, financial rigor, and launch execution. Role Overview The Business Development Manager will focus on external growth and commercial execution, supporting acquisitions, partnerships, innovation development and product launches through financial modeling, deal support, and business case development. This role sits at the intersection of business development, technical feasibility, and commercialization, ensuring that opportunities moving out of the lab are supported by clear economic logic, execution planning, and leadership-ready decision materials. Key Responsibilities Product Pipeline & Launch Execution • Own the development of commercial business cases for new product launches. • Translate R&D validation into launch-ready plans (market sizing, pricing logic, cost assumptions, margins). • Partner with Business Units to accelerate time-to-launch and improve consistency of commercial planning. • Support go-to-market strategy and launch sequencing across regions. External Partnerships & Market Intelligence • Evaluate and structure external partnerships and supplier relationships. • Conduct market and competitive analysis to support growth strategy. • Track performance of partnerships and acquisitions against original business cases. Internal Bridge: R&D Commercial • Act as a commercial interface between R&D, Sales, and Operations. • Support project execution from lab to plant where commercial readiness is the limiting factor. • Engage with regulatory experts as needed to support commercialization assumptions. #LI-DNP TECHNICAL SKILLS Required • o Bachelor's degree in Engineering, Life Sciences, or a related technical field. • o Minimum 7 years’ experience in business development or corporate strategy. • o Proven experience building and managing financial models, valuation analyses and business plans. • o Ability to translate technical developments to plain language suitable for wide audiences. An asset • o Additional credentials such as MBA/CFA • o Experience in technical and/or R&D adjacent business roles • o Advanced proficiency in M365 PERSONAL ABILITIES Required • o Strong organizational skills and execution mindset to keep multiple projects moving smoothly. • o Ability to collaborate with stakeholders across different areas. • o Outstanding communication skills, both written and verbal, to build relationships and share ideas clearly. • o Strategic and results-driven, comfortable navigating change and focused on achieving goals. GENERAL CRITERIA Required • o Willingness and ability to travel internationally for up to 8 weeks per year. ORGANIZATION Lallemand is a privately held Canadian company founded in the late 19th century, which develops, produces, and markets microorganisms for various markets. The administrative offices of the parent company are in Montreal, Canada. Today, Lallemand employs more than 5,000 people working in more than 45 countries on 5 continents. Lallemand Biofuels & Distilled Spirits is a leading fermentation ingredients supplier (yeast, yeast nutrients, and antimicrobials) for both the bioethanol and distilled spirits markets. Our clients depend on Lallemand ingredients for their fermentation processes as well as consulting and training services for those sectors. Supported by an extensive network of warehouses, Lallemand Biofuels & Distilled Spirits' main office is located in the United States, with satellite branches worldwide. In both the biofuel and spirits industries, the team behind the operation demonstrates an unparalleled sense of innovation, aiming to provide the best possible quality of fermentation. Please take note that accommodations will be provided in all parts of the hiring process. Applicants need to make their needs known in advance. Apply tot his job
Apply Now →
← Back to Home